changarro

chahn-GAH-rroh · noun · slang

Small shop / hole-in-the-wall business

People Also Ask

What does changarro mean?

It's Mexican slang for a small, informal business or shop, often a modest hole-in-the-wall stand or stall.

Is changarro a rude word?

No, it's casual and clean, though it can carry a slightly humble or unpretentious tone about the size of the business.

How do you use changarro in a sentence?

You use it for any little enterprise, e.g. 'Puso un changarro de tacos en la esquina' — he set up a little taco stand on the corner.
